Cedar vs Heat-Treated Hemlock for a Small Sauna

For a small two or three person sauna, cedar typically costs 20 to 35 percent more than heat-treated hemlock but brings natural decay resistance and a stronger, more recognizable scent, while hemlock is thermally modified rather than naturally oily, runs lighter in color and price, and holds up nearly as well once it has gone through the heat-treatment process. Neither is the wrong choice for a compact cabin; the decision mostly comes down to budget, scent preference, and whether the unit sits indoors or outdoors.

What Actually Separates These Two Woods?

Western red cedar is a naturally aromatic softwood with oils that resist rot, insects, and moisture without any added treatment, which is why it has been the default sauna wood for decades. Heat-treated hemlock starts as a plain, moisture-prone softwood that goes through a thermal modification process, essentially baking the wood at high heat in a low-oxygen environment, which changes its cell structure, drives out sugars that would otherwise feed decay, and leaves it more dimensionally stable and less prone to warping than untreated hemlock. The visual difference is immediate: cedar runs in warm reddish and honey tones with visible grain, while heat-treated hemlock comes out a more uniform light caramel to brown, closer to the color of coffee with cream.

How Much Does the Wood Cost for a Small Cabin?

Because a small sauna footprint, typically 4×4 to 5×6 feet, needs far less lumber than a six or eight person cabin, the dollar gap between species is smaller in absolute terms even though the percentage difference holds. Cedar paneling for a compact two or three person build commonly runs somewhere in the range of $1,200 to $2,200 depending on grade and supplier, while heat-treated hemlock for the same footprint often lands 20 to 35 percent lower. On a small build, that gap is frequently the difference between an entry-level unit and a mid-tier one with a better heater or added bench options, which is one reason hemlock has gained ground with buyers working from a tighter total budget. Which Holds Up Better to Heat and Humidity?

Cedar’s natural oils give it a built-in resistance to moisture damage that does not depend on any factory process, which is part of why it has such a long track record in wet, high-heat environments. Heat-treated hemlock has no natural oils, but the thermal modification closes the wood’s cellular structure and reduces its capacity to absorb water to a level that, for indoor residential use, comes close to cedar’s performance. In a compact cabin where humidity from each session has less total air volume to disperse into, both woods handle the load fine as long as the door is left open to dry between uses and the unit is not exposed to standing water at the base. Outdoor exposure is where the gap widens more, since cedar’s oils continue protecting exposed exterior wood over years of rain and sun in a way that treated hemlock, while stable, tends to need a fresh sealant coat somewhat sooner to maintain the same protection.

Which Wood Smells Stronger, and Does It Matter?

Cedar has a distinct, resinous scent that many people associate with the sauna experience itself, and that scent is more concentrated in a small cabin simply because there is less air to dilute it. Heat-treated hemlock loses most of its natural wood scent during the thermal process, leaving a much milder, almost neutral smell. For a small unit shared by people sensitive to strong scents, or installed somewhere with limited ventilation, hemlock’s muted profile can be the more practical choice, especially if the sauna sits near a bedroom or living space where a lingering resin smell might carry through shared ductwork or a nearby doorway. For anyone who wants that classic, unmistakable cedar aroma the moment the door opens, that same intensity is arguably the whole point of choosing it, and it tends to fade to a background note rather than disappearing entirely as the wood ages over the first year or two of regular use.

Which Makes More Sense for an Indoor vs Outdoor Small Sauna?

For an indoor small sauna, tucked into a basement, garage corner, or spare room, heat-treated hemlock’s lower price and reduced maintenance needs make it a straightforward pick, since it will not face the sustained weather exposure that tests cedar’s natural advantages. For an outdoor small sauna exposed to rain, snow load, and direct sun, cedar’s decades-long track record and self-renewing natural oils tend to justify the higher upfront cost, particularly for owners who would rather not reapply sealant as often. Either wood, properly finished and maintained, should last well past a decade in a small residential cabin. Buyers splitting the difference sometimes choose hemlock for the frame and bench substructure, where cost savings add up over more linear feet of material, and cedar for the visible interior wall panels and benches where the scent and warmer tone are most noticeable during a session.

Do the Health Associations Around Sauna Use Depend on Wood Species?

The cardiovascular associations reported in the research are tied to the heat exposure and frequency of sauna bathing itself, not to which wood the cabin is built from. A 2018 review in Mayo Clinic Proceedings and a 2023 follow-up review in the same journal both summarized associations between regular sauna bathing and cardiovascular outcomes across long-running cohort studies, and a 2018 paper in the American Journal of Physiology – Regulatory, Integrative and Comparative Physiology reviewed the physiological effects of heat exposure more broadly. None of that research distinguishes cedar from hemlock or any other wood; the wood choice is a durability, cost, and comfort decision layered on top of a heat exposure that works the same regardless of what the walls are made from.

Frequently Asked Questions

Is cedar or heat-treated hemlock better for a small sauna? Cedar costs more and has a stronger scent, while hemlock runs 20 to 35 percent cheaper with a milder profile. Both work well in a properly ventilated compact cabin.

Does cedar or hemlock resist moisture better in a small sauna? Cedar’s natural oils give it inherent resistance. Heat-treated hemlock’s thermal modification closes its cell structure, bringing its moisture resistance close to cedar’s for indoor use.

Why does wood choice matter more in a small sauna than a large one? Less total wood surface means resin bleed, scent, and surface heat from a given species feel more concentrated than in a larger room.

Does heat-treated hemlock get as hot to the touch as cedar? The two feel similar, though hemlock’s tighter cell structure can feel marginally cooler on the bench early in a session.
